What affects the price

When you look at the cost of getting an EV charger installed at your home, a few main things change the bottom line. The biggest factor is how far your electrical panel is from where you want the charger; longer wiring runs mean more materials and labor. You also have to consider if your current panel has enough available amperage to handle the new circuit, or if you need an expensive service upgrade. Additionally, the type of charger you choose and the difficulty of running conduit through walls or attics play a role.

What are the different types of electric car charging stations?

Electric car charging stations are primarily categorized by their charging speed, known as Level 1, Level 2, and DC Fast Charging. Level 1 uses a standard 120-volt outlet, offering the slowest charge, often suitable for overnight topping off. Level 2, which requires a 240-volt connection, is the most common for home installations, significantly reducing charging times. DC Fast Chargers, typically found in public locations, provide the quickest charge but require specialized infrastructure and are not usually practical for residential use. Understanding these levels helps determine the best fit for your needs in Dayton.

Can I install an EV charger myself at home?

While some individuals with extensive electrical knowledge might attempt a DIY EV charger installation, it's generally not recommended for homeowners. Proper installation involves understanding local electrical codes, load calculations, and safety protocols to prevent fire hazards or damage to your vehicle's battery. Licensed electricians have the expertise to correctly size wiring, breakers, and conduit, ensuring the system is safe and code-compliant. What should I look for in an electric car charger for my home?

When choosing an electric car charger for your home, consider the charging speed (Level 2 is recommended for most), connector type compatible with your vehicle, and any smart features you desire. Smart chargers can offer app control, scheduling, and energy monitoring, which can be beneficial for managing your electricity costs. Ensure the charger is UL-certified for safety.
